8. RETURNS
Voluntary Right of Withdrawal
Consumers may withdraw from the purchase within 14 calendar days without justification.
The return period starts from the day the user or a third party (other than the courier) takes physical possession of the goods.

To exercise this right, users must notify Beeloom via the contact form or:

Returned items must be in original condition and packaging, with all documentation and a copy of the invoice. Return shipping is at the user's cost.
Refunds will be made using the original payment method within 14 days, but may be withheld until goods are received or proof of return is provided.

Exceptions
Withdrawal does not apply to:

  • Customised products

  • Perishable items

  • Opened hygiene or health-related items

  • Fully performed services where execution has begun with explicit consent

Faulty Goods or Delivery Errors
If a product is defective or does not match the order, users must contact Beeloom immediately.
Beeloom will offer a refund or replacement depending on availability. The refund includes delivery and return costs.
Returned items may need to be dropped off at a collection point.

Gifts
Promotional gifts are not eligible for voluntary return, replacement, or exchange, even if defective or received in random colour/model.

WARRANTY
New products carry a 3-year legal warranty (2 years if purchased before 01/01/2022).
Beeloom is responsible for transport, repair or replacement costs under warranty.
Users must report defects within 2 months of becoming aware.

Repairs or part replacements are subject to Technical Service evaluation. If damage results from misuse, wear, or other exclusions, costs will be charged to the user.
